Conference to review European market development work

Opening the Conference, Comrade Ta Hoang Linh, Director of the European - American Market Department, on behalf of the Department's leaders and civil servants, summarized the development of the European - American market in 2024 and the work orientation in 2025.

Accordingly, in 2024, although the world and regional market situation has many complex fluctuations that negatively affect production, business and import-export activities, under the direction of the leaders of the Ministry of Industry and Trade, the European - American Market Department has coordinated with relevant agencies at home and abroad, actively proposed many solutions, implemented many practical activities to support businesses to restore production and promote import-export activities. These activities have actively supported Vietnam's market development, not only exploiting traditional markets, expanding potential markets but also removing trade barriers, protecting the interests of Vietnamese enterprises in the international arena. In which, the following main activities have been well implemented:

Closely monitor and research market situations and policies, advise and propose mechanisms, policies and measures for market development: develop many in-depth reports on markets in the Europe - America region to serve the direction and management work; Prepare well the contents on economic - trade cooperation to serve the leaders of the Party, State, Government and National Assembly in meetings with partners in the region.

Implementing free trade agreements, existing cooperation mechanisms and frameworks, building new cooperation frameworks: Proactively and effectively implementing FTAs ​​that have come into effect in the region including: EVFTA, VN-EAEU, UKVFTA, CPTPP, VCFTA. Focusing on the work of: researching and taking advantage of incentives in the Agreements, disseminating information, removing difficulties and obstacles in the implementation process. Successfully organizing 03 Intergovernmental Committee Meetings with countries in the European region (Bulgaria, Kazakhstan and Russia), 03 other Meetings with countries in the Americas region (Canada, United States, Chile). These Meetings focus on removing difficulties and obstacles in bilateral economic and trade relations, thereby creating the most favorable conditions for business operations. Building 03 new cooperation frameworks with Romania, Ireland, Sweden in the fields of economics, trade and industry.

International negotiations, expanding export markets, policy advocacy, removing market barriers: Participate in promoting the launch of FTA negotiations with the MERCOSUR bloc; Participate in supporting the handling of anti-dumping and anti-subsidy investigations, handling issues related to other trade barriers such as: Food safety and hygiene and SPS quarantine, standards in goods production, seafood exploitation and fishing, etc.

Trade promotion, supporting businesses in finding and expanding export markets: (i) providing updated information on the market through publications, articles, websites and organizing forums, seminars and conferences; (ii) organizing activities to support businesses in accessing the market, especially synchronously implementing from central to local levels the activities of the Project "Promoting Vietnamese Enterprises to directly participate in foreign distribution networks by 2030", typically successfully organizing a series of events connecting international supply chains "Viet Nam International Sourcing 2024" in June 2024 in Ho Chi Minh City, Vietnamese goods weeks in countries: Japan, Germany, UAE; Supporting connections with overseas Vietnamese businesses through providing information through the ConnectViet section on the Ministry of Industry and Trade's electronic information portal; Organize a conference to connect overseas Vietnamese intellectuals and businessmen in the United States (November 2024) with the theme: "Promoting the resources of overseas Vietnamese intellectuals and businessmen in the United States, contributing to the development of Vietnam's industry, energy and trade".

Directing the Vietnam Trade Office system in the Europe - America region to effectively perform the task of providing market information, participating in protecting the interests of Vietnamese goods enterprises in the markets, promoting trade and investment in the host countries; effectively supporting domestic and foreign enterprises in business, import-export and investment activities.

At the Conference, leaders and experts of the Department discussed, reported, and evaluated the advantages, difficulties, and lessons learned for the development of the European - American market in 2025 and proposed key tasks in the coming time.

Deputy Minister Nguyen Hoang Long

Speaking at the Conference, Deputy Minister of Industry and Trade Nguyen Hoang Long commended, acknowledged and highly appreciated the results of market development work carried out by the Department of European - American Markets in 2024, especially in the context of the region being the place with the most geopolitical and economic fluctuations in the world. In addition, the Deputy Minister pointed out the limitations and causes in market development work in this region. It is forecasted that in 2025, in addition to favorable factors, the international, regional and domestic situation is forecast to continue to develop in a complex and unpredictable manner; production and business activities of the business community continue to face many difficulties and challenges. The Deputy Minister suggested that the Department of European - American Markets focus on the following main orientations:

Firstly, thoroughly grasp the viewpoints, guidelines and policies of the Party and State in foreign affairs to successfully complete the assigned goals of the Industry and Trade sector in 2025. Make the most of political and diplomatic relations to develop economic, trade and investment cooperation with countries in the region.

Second, focus on grasping the situation and policy changes of the host country to advise the Party, State, Government, Ministry of Industry and Trade... on appropriate and feasible policy responses; At the same time, promote policy research, market research, explore opportunities to promote economic, trade, industrial, energy and investment cooperation commensurate with the political and diplomatic relations and position of the country.

Third, continue to promote the effective implementation of free trade agreements and existing cooperation mechanisms (Intergovernmental Committee, Joint Committee, Trade Council) with countries in the region; at the same time, study the upgrading and signing of new FTAs ​​with potential markets...

Fourth, pay attention to and take care of the work of the ministries (from recruitment, training, planning, appointment, rotation and implementation of personnel policies. Especially the training and coaching of young cadres.

Fifth, improve the bridging function between domestic production and import-export enterprises and foreign enterprises and vice versa.

Sixth, coordinate with the Ministry's Office and domestic and foreign media agencies within the Ministry to provide and orient information on policies and markets to relevant agencies and businesses.

On behalf of the European - American Market Department, Director Ta Hoang Linh spoke to accept the Deputy Minister's direction and expressed his determination to effectively implement the assigned tasks in 2025 and contribute to the effective and sustainable development of the European - American market./.

In 2024, the import-export turnover between Vietnam and the European - American market region will witness a strong recovery and growth compared to 2023. The total import-export turnover is estimated at about 250 billion USD, an increase of 18.5% compared to 2023, of which exports are estimated at 202.1 billion USD, an increase of 20.3%; imports are estimated at 47.9 billion USD, an increase of 12.6%. The trade surplus with the European - American market will exceed 150 billion USD for the first time, estimated at 154.2 billion USD.

Regarding exports, Vietnam's key export markets in the Europe-America region all witnessed strong growth in 2024. Specifically, exports to the US market in 2024 are estimated to reach 119.3 billion USD, up 23% compared to 2023; the EU market is estimated to reach 51.9 billion USD, up 18.8%; the markets of CPTPP countries in the Americas (Canada, Mexico, Chile, Peru) are estimated to reach 13.7 billion USD, up 17%; the UK is estimated to reach 7.6 billion USD, up 19.6%; EAEU countries are estimated to reach 3.3 billion, up 31.5%. Only exports to Mercosur countries will witness a decrease of 6.5%, estimated to reach 3.4 billion USD in 2024.

Vietnam's key export items to the European and American markets in 2024 all witnessed impressive recovery and growth compared to 2023. Specifically, exports of Computers, electronic products and components are estimated at 34.6 billion USD, up 39.7%; Other machinery, equipment, tools and spare parts are estimated at 33 billion USD, up 24.4%; Textiles and garments are estimated at 23.4 billion USD, up 12%; Telephones of all kinds and components are estimated at 22.3 billion USD, up 12.5%; Footwear of all kinds is estimated at 16.7 billion USD, up 16.5%; Wood and wood products are estimated at nearly 10 billion USD, up 21.9%; Means of transport and spare parts are estimated at nearly 6 billion USD, up 7%; Seafood is estimated at more than 4 billion USD, up 18.8%.
